Using the above equations, the z score for the composite score is Xc - M, z = c (5) XC SD XC The z score for the composite (z, ) can be multiplied by the standarddeviation ofan obtained score and the prod WebSimple averaging is the most commonly used approach to creating a composite variable. In this approach, the composite variable (symbolized as C) is created by summing z scores of the original variables: C = z 1 + z 2 + … z p, where z = X-X ¯ S D. The z scores have a mean of 0 with a range from negative to positive numbers. Such ...

WebMar 26, 2024 · With z-scores (what I'd call unit variance standardisation) this still happens, but somewhat less. You could also standardise to unit MAD (mean absolute deviation from the median) and zero median, which gives the outliers smaller influence on the other observations (and makes the outliers even more outlying). WebDec 28, 2024 · A Z-score uses standard deviation to indicate the difference between a data set’s mean and an individual observation. When the Z-score is 2.0, for example, the observed data is two standard deviations away from the mean. Z-scores help you evaluate how normal an observation is for a given data set.
